Kannada Superstar Kichcha Sudeep’s Mother Saroja Sanjeev Passes Away

Kichcha Sudeep's mother passed away on October 20.

Kannada superstar Kichcha Sudeep’s mother Saroja Sanjeev passed away on October 20 due to age-related ailments. His family and friends will reach their residence to pay their last respects. According to reports, she took her last breath in Bengaluru’s Apollo Hospital and her last rites will take place in the city today. 

Deputy Chief Minister of Karnataka, DK Shivakumar, offered his condolences to Kichcha Sudeep on X. He wrote, “I pray that the departed soul may rest in eternal peace and may the Lord grant Sudeep and his family the strength to bear the pain of bereavement.”

Actors’s Mother’s Day post from 2019 has also been going viral on social media. He had posted, “A very happy mother’s day to every mother,, for ur unconditional luv n never ending sacrifices. Happy mothers day to u too Amma,, For just about everything.”
